WHEN, many years hence, a history of the study of fossil plants during the first decade of the twentieth century is being elaborated, it will be found that two discoveries, announced in 1903 and 1906 respectively, will stand out as particularly far-reaching in their “after effects.” These contributions will be found to rank in importance with any that may be cited in the whole range of the previous history of the study of paæobotany.
